Quick answer

Concrete driveways, paving and masonry take high pressure well. Aged roof tiles, old render and soft timber do not. Knowing which is which is the whole job and on a Myaree home it is the difference between a clean surface and a damaged one.

What the work involves

  • Protect surrounds and manage the runoff. Plants covered, windows and fittings protected and the considerable volume of dirty water directed somewhere sensible rather than into a soakwell it will block
  • Identify the surface before anything else. Concrete, brick, limestone, render, timber, coated steel and aged roof tile all behave differently under pressure. Asbestos cement is identified and left alone, because cleaning it releases fibres
  • Match nozzle and standoff to the surface. A pencil jet concentrates enormous force into a tiny area and will carve concrete. A fan tip spreads the same energy across a band. Doubling the distance from the surface dramatically reduces impact force

Common questions about pressure cleaning in Myaree

Why does the nozzle matter so much?

It determines how the same energy is delivered. A narrow jet concentrates it and will gouge. A wider fan spreads it across a band and cleans without cutting. Turbo tips belong on driveways and never on roofs.

Will it damage my mortar?

It can. Aged mortar in brickwork or paving joints is softer than the material around it and washes out under a concentrated jet. That is repointing work created by the cleaning.

What about asbestos?

Never pressure clean it. Cleaning fibre cement sheeting releases fibres and it is both dangerous and unlawful. We identify suspected material and decline the work rather than proceed.

Where does all the water go?

Into your drainage, carrying whatever came off the surface. On a large job that is a genuine volume and it can silt a soakwell. Managing the runoff is part of doing it properly.

What to ask whoever quotes you

Compare scopes rather than totals. A cheaper quote is frequently a different job and the gap is usually treatment time, film build, or repairs excluded and raised later. Ask for the product name, coat count and what happens if more damage is found once work starts.
